Transaction d21d8b5539898d663ec46daa04e3f5eeea2b7b021936f54da9e003b093103d6c
1 Input
1 Output
-
d21d8b5539898d663ec46daa04e3f5eeea2b7b021936f54da9e003b093103d6c:0
- value
- 95392732
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42ad952cd0276b4e299e441a88de58fa386b2d14 OP_EQUALVERIFY OP_CHECKSIG
- address
- 175ZYQACrgMVhpsx8rfJDpJTacPuMPrT5g